Urinary tract infections (UTIs) are among the most common bacterial infections, particularly in women, though men can experience them too. They are often painful, causing frequent urges to urinate, burning sensations, and discomfort in the lower abdomen. While antibiotics are the standard medical treatment, nature offers support as well. Certain fruits contain compounds that can help reduce symptoms, prevent bacteria from multiplying, and support faster recovery when used alongside medical care.

Cranberries – The Most Famous UTI Fighter

Cranberries are perhaps the most well-known fruit linked to urinary health. They contain proanthocyanidins, plant compounds that make it harder for bacteria—especially E. coli—to stick to the walls of the urinary tract. Drinking unsweetened cranberry juice or eating dried cranberries can help reduce the risk of recurrent UTIs. While cranberries may not “cure” an active infection, they play a strong role in prevention and long-term urinary health.

Blueberries – A Close Relative of Cranberries

Like cranberries, blueberries contain similar anti-adhesive compounds that prevent bacteria from clinging to urinary tract tissues. Packed with antioxidants and vitamin C, they also help strengthen the immune system, making the body better equipped to fight infections. Adding fresh blueberries to your daily diet can provide gentle but steady support.

Oranges and Citrus Fruits – Boosting Immunity

Oranges, lemons, and grapefruits are rich in vitamin C, which acidifies the urine slightly and creates an environment less favorable to bacterial growth. Vitamin C also supports immune function, helping the body fight off infections more effectively. Drinking a glass of orange juice or adding lemon to water can be a simple, natural addition to UTI management.

Pineapple – Anti-Inflammatory Power

Pineapple contains bromelain, an enzyme with natural anti-inflammatory properties. This can help ease the discomfort and swelling often associated with UTIs. When combined with medical treatment, pineapple may support faster relief and recovery. Opt for fresh pineapple rather than canned varieties, which often contain added sugars that may worsen symptoms.

Watermelon – Hydration Hero

Staying hydrated is one of the most important factors in flushing bacteria out of the urinary system. Watermelon, with its high water content, is not only refreshing but also helps increase urination frequency, washing away bacteria naturally. It’s an excellent fruit to consume during warm months or when dealing with UTIs.

Papaya – Immune-Boosting Benefits

Papaya is rich in vitamin C and antioxidants, both of which help the body fight infection. Its enzymes also support digestion and overall health, contributing indirectly to recovery and prevention.

Final Thoughts

While these fruits can help support urinary tract health, they should not replace prescribed antibiotics when an infection is present. Instead, they serve as natural allies—helping to prevent bacteria from thriving, easing discomfort, and strengthening the body’s defenses. For those prone to recurrent UTIs, regularly incorporating cranberries, blueberries, citrus, pineapple, watermelon, and papaya into the diet may help reduce the risk of repeat infections.

As always, anyone experiencing UTI symptoms should consult a healthcare provider promptly. Combining medical care with natural support offers the best path to comfort, recovery, and long-term prevention.
